How It Actually Works: A Clear Explanation
A warrant is a court order that authorizes law enforcement to take specific action. In Pierce County, warrants are typically issued by a judge or commissioner based on a prosecutorβs request. There are different types, such as arrest warrants, bench warrants, and search warrants. An arrest warrant allows police to detain a person believed to have committed a crime. A bench warrant often appears when someone misses a court date. A search warrant gives officers permission to search a location for evidence. Each type follows its own rules and timeline. The Truth About Pierce County Warrants: What to Expect and How to Act starts with knowing which kind you are dealing with.
Once a warrant exists, it can be entered into state and national databases. Law enforcement officers can see it during routine checks. The public can often search online through court portals or third-party sites, but rules vary. Some records are easy to find, while others require a visit to a courthouse. If you are named in a warrant, you might first learn about it during a traffic stop or when you contact an agency. The process moves quickly, and there is rarely a warning. Understanding this helps people act instead of freeze.
Common Questions People Have
People often wonder how a warrant shows up in everyday life. What happens if I have an active warrant in Pierce County and I get pulled over? If law enforcement runs your license during a traffic stop and sees an active warrant, they can arrest you on the spot. That is why it is unwise to ignore a warrant, even if you think it is a mistake. Another common question is about public access. Can anyone look up my warrant information? Many court records are public, but sensitive details may be limited. You can usually view basic information online, but complete records might require a courthouse visit. People also ask whether they can resolve a warrant without going to jail. In many cases, yes. Contacting the court or a lawyer to discuss surrender options can help manage the situation calmly.

Things People Often Misunderstand
There are many myths that can lead to poor decisions. One myth is that if you do not know about a warrant, it will not affect you. Warrants do not disappear just because you ignore them. They remain active until they are resolved. Another misunderstanding is that all warrants result in immediate jail time. That is not always true. Some cases can be handled with a phone call or a written submission, depending on the court. People also believe that only guilty people have warrants. Sometimes errors happen, or names are confused. Double-checking information and getting professional guidance can protect your rights. Clearing up these misunderstandings is a key part of building trust.
